10 Commandments of Shooting

  1. Accord total respect to every gun whether it’s loaded or otherwise. This is the cardinal rule of a gun safety.
  2. Carry only empty guns but not the ammunitions purchased from the armoury into your car.
  3. Always be sure that the barrel and action are clear of obstructions.
  4. Always carry your gun so that you can control the direction of the muzzle, even if you stumble.
